Break-Glass Access — Wardenwiki RBAC

Release managers normally hold the Publisher role only. If the admin group is unreachable during a release freeze, break-glass grants temporary Steward rights on Wardenwiki. Log the incident first. Activate via the emergency panel; access expires after two hours. All actions are audited. The panel requires the break-glass passphrase stored immediately below this line.

unlock words, hahip-yagef: zorok-novmir-zorix-silax

- [ ] **Step 7: Breaker override escrow.** After sealing the signing keys for the Tallgrove upstream API circuit breaker, confirm the support team can force the breaker open during a full outage. The override bundle lives in the sealed escrow drawer and is useless without its unlock phrase. Two ceremony witnesses must initial this step before proceeding. The escrow bundle is decrypted with the recovery passphrase that follows.

vault phrase of kahip-kahop = holath-quenmir

**Mgmt Meeting Minutes — Retiring the Brightline Range**

Quick recap for sales leads at Fenholt Supplies: we agreed to retire the Brightline fixture range by year-end. Remaining stock moves to clearance pricing next month, and accounts on standing orders get migrated to the Lumetta range. Trade-in incentives were approved in principle. The confidential note on next steps sits just below.

board note of bajof-bajeg: The pricing group signed off on a budget of $13.4 million for Project Sildor. The renewal with Lamixek Holdings closes at $48.9 million a year, 49 percent above the last contract.